### How does hypertourism impact public transportation systems?
Hypertourism significantly strains public transportation networks as the sheer volume of visitors, especially during peak seasons, overwhelms capacity. This leads to overcrowded buses, trains, and other transit options, causing delays, reducing the quality of experience for both tourists and locals, and increasing wear and tear on the infrastructure itself. For example, in Venice, the constant influx of tourists has led to severe congestion on vaporetto (water bus) lines, impacting the daily commute of residents and the overall efficiency of the public transport system. Furthermore, the focus on getting large numbers of tourists to main attractions can neglect the needs of local communities for reliable, uncongested transport.

### What are the consequences of hypertourism on sanitation and waste management?
The increase in visitor numbers due to hypertourism places immense pressure on sanitation and waste management systems. Destinations often struggle to cope with the amplified demand for services, leading to overflowing bins, inadequate waste collection, and potential pollution of local environments, including beaches and natural reserves. A study on popular beach destinations revealed a significant increase in plastic waste directly correlated with tourist influx, impacting marine ecosystems and local water quality. This over-reliance on fragile ecosystems for waste disposal is unsustainable and directly harms the very natural beauty that attracts tourists in the first place.

### How do these infrastructure strains affect local residents?
Local residents in hypertourism-affected areas often experience a diminished quality of life due to the strain on public services. Overcrowded public transport makes daily commutes difficult and time-consuming, while increased pressure on sanitation can lead to a decline in local environmental quality and public health concerns. In some mountain communities, for instance, the sheer volume of visitors has led to increased traffic congestion and a reduction in the availability of local services, such as healthcare, due to the overwhelming demand during peak tourist seasons. This displacement and degradation of local services are significant consequences of unchecked tourism growth.

### How can sustainable tourism practices alleviate infrastructure pressure?
Sustainable tourism practices aim to minimize the negative impacts of tourism on the environment, society, and economy, including easing the pressure on infrastructure. Strategies such as promoting off-season travel, encouraging longer stays to distribute visitor impact, developing alternative attractions away from main hubs, and implementing visitor caps or entry fees can significantly alleviate the strain on public transport, sanitation, and other essential services. For example, destinations that have implemented visitor management systems have reported improvements in managing crowds and reducing the environmental footprint.
